Ingredients

To create the authentic Carrabba’s Mama’s Chicken Soup, we gather fresh, wholesome ingredients that promise rich flavor and comforting warmth. Each component plays a vital role in building the soup’s signature taste and texture.

Here is a detailed list of the essential ingredients, arranged in the order we use them:

Ingredient Quantity Preparation Details
Boneless, skinless chicken breasts 2 large Cut into bite-size pieces
Extra virgin olive oil 2 tablespoons For sautéing
Yellow onion 1 medium Diced finely
Carrots 2 medium Sliced thinly
Celery stalks 2 stalks Sliced thinly
Garlic cloves 3 cloves Minced
Chicken broth or stock 6 cups Preferably low sodium
Ditalini pasta 1 cup Small tubular pasta
Roma tomatoes 1 cup Diced
Fresh spinach leaves 2 cups Roughly chopped
Fresh parsley 2 tablespoons Chopped finely
Salt To taste Preferably kosher salt
Black pepper To taste Freshly ground
Dried oregano 1 teaspoon Adds Italian aroma
Red pepper flakes ¼ teaspoon Optional, for subtle heat

Pro Tip: Using fresh herbs like parsley and spinach enhances the soup’s vibrant color and depth of flavor, staying true to the Italian family tradition that inspired this recipe.

Directions

Follow these precise steps to craft the authentic Carrabba’s Mama’s Chicken Soup that warms the soul and delights the palate.

Making the Broth

  1. Heat 2 tablespoons of olive oil in a large stockpot or Dutch oven over medium heat until shimmering.
  2. Add the chopped onions, celery, and carrots to the pot. Sauté for 5 to 7 minutes until the vegetables soften and the onions become translucent.
  3. Stir in 3 minced garlic cloves and cook for 30 seconds until fragrant—avoid browning to keep the broth clear.
  4. Pour in 8 cups of chicken broth and bring the mixture to a gentle boil.
  5. Skim any foam or impurities from the surface using a spoon or fine mesh skimmer to ensure a clear, flavorful broth.

“A clear and well-developed broth is the foundation of Carrabba’s Mama’s Chicken Soup.”

Cooking the Chicken and Vegetables

  1. Add the seasoned bite-sized chicken breasts to the simmering broth.
  2. Reduce the heat to low and simmer uncovered for 10 minutes until the chicken is cooked through and tender.
  3. Stir in the diced tomatoes and prepared green beans now. This timing keeps the vegetables vibrant and crisp.
  4. Simmer for an additional 10 minutes, allowing flavors to meld and vegetables to soften perfectly but retain texture.

Combining Ingredients and Simmering

  1. Toss in ½ cup of cooked pasta or small noodles to the pot. Stir well.
  2. Add freshly chopped Italian parsley and basil to the soup and stir gently.
  3. Simmer uncovered for 3 to 5 minutes, just until the pasta is al dente—avoid overcooking.
  4. Season with sal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ste. Adjust seasoning carefully.
  5. Remove from heat, cover, and let the soup rest for 5 minutes to deepen flavors.

Storage and Make-Ahead Instructions

To enjoy Carrabba’s Mama’s Chicken Soup anytime, mastering proper storage and make-ahead techniques is essential. Here’s how we keep this comforting dish fresh and flavorful for days to come.

Refrigeration

  • Allow the soup to cool to room temperature before refrigerating to preserve texture and taste.
  • Transfer to an airtight container to prevent moisture loss and absorption of other flavors.
  • Store in the refrigerator for up to 4 days.

Freezing

  • Cool the soup completely before freezing.
  • Use freezer-safe containers or heavy-duty freezer bags, leaving about 1 inch of headspace to allow for expansion.
  • Label containers with the date to track freshness.
  • Freeze for up to 3 months for optimal flavor and quality.
  • Thaw overnight in the refrigerator before reheating gently on the stovetop.

Reheating Instructions

  • Reheat on medium-low heat stirring occasionally to prevent sticking.
  • Add a splash of chicken broth or water if the soup appears too thick.
  • Heat until warmed through but avoid boiling, as it can toughen the chicken and alter vegetable textures.

Make-Ahead Tips

  • Prepare the soup entirely and refrigerate for up to 24 hours to allow flavors to meld, enhancing the rich savory profile.
  • Cook pasta separately and add it just before serving to maintain its perfect texture.
  • Chop fresh herbs and store them separately; add these as a final garnish to preserve their vibrant color and flavor.
